Sequim Bay State Park – Address Failing Retaining Wall
PROJECT DESCRIPTION: |
The project will remove the existing failing retaining wall and all creosote-treated materials from the site. Replace the failing retaining wall with a gravity wall system, constructed with a combination of cast-in-place concrete and precast concrete blocks. |
PROJECT LOCATION: |
269035 Highway 101, Sequim, WA 98382 |
ESTIMATED |
$925,000-$1,025,000 |
BID OPENING TIME: |
1:00PM, Friday, May 18, 2018 |
PREBID WALKTHROUGH: |
10:00AM, Wednesday, May 9, 2018; meet at the boat launch at Sequim Bay State Park. |
